Phil the New-Phlebotomy Tech is collecting blood for a blood glucose level and PT, PTT. What color tubes should Phil choose, and in which order should he choose them?
  1. Red top only
  2. Light blue top, then light gray top
  3. Lavender top, then light blue top
  4. Light gray top, then light blue top
Explanation
Answer: B - Phil should choose a light blue top for the PT and PTT, followed by a light gray top for the glucose level. Blood collection tubes are color- coded, indicating what sort of additive the tube may contain. The light blue top contains sodium citrate, which will not interfere with the glucose level.
